Susan Bedusa is an award-winning producer with over 20 years in the industry. She works closely with filmmakers from development thru distribution.

Some of her films include PROCESSION, which had its world premiere at Telluride Film Festival where it was acquired by Netflix and shortlisted for the 2022 Academy Award for Best Documentary. Susan’s producing work also includes BERNSTEIN’S WALL, which played at both Tribeca and Telluride and will be released next year, BISBEE ’17 (Sundance, POV), DRUNK STONED BRILLIANT DEAD (Sundance, Magnolia Pictures, Showtime Networks), and AN OMAR BROADWAY FILM (Tribeca, HBO Films). In television, Susan recently Executive Produced a three-part documentary series for Paramount and is currently in development with another major platform on a four-episode music series. Susan began her career working for producers Amy Robinson and Bob Balaban before becoming Director of Development for Fine Line Features founder Ira Deutchman. She grew up working and watching movies at her parents’ arthouse theatre, the SoNo Cinema in Connecticut.&lt;br /&gt;<br /><br /> &lt;br /&gt;<br /><br />
